Memorial match for fan who collapsed at match

EVO-STIK League Mickleover Sports are set to host League Two Burton Albion next week for the KC Trust Trophy.

First played last season, the fixture in memory of Keith Calladine who was a supporter of both clubs, is taking place on Wednesday (23 July) with half of the proceeds from the 7.15 kick off going to the British Heart Foundation.

The fan and sheet metal worker had suffered from heart problems for a number of years and had a quadruple bypass in 2009. He was watching Mickleover Sports in action at the Raygar Stadium in April 2012 when he collapsed and died. The day before the 67-year-old had enjoyed a Burton Albion game at the Pirelli Stadium and was a regular at both clubs.

The KC Trust was set up by Mr Calladine’s son Paul to provide defibrillators in Derbyshire to prevent others suffering in the same way. The first one was presented to Mickleover after last season's inaugural memorial match and he has continued to raise thousands of pounds for charity by running in several marathons for the British Heart Foundation and the Papworth Hospital.
